Understanding API Management
What is an API?
An API (Application Programming Interface) is a set of rules and protocols for building and interacting with software applications. It defines the methods that applications can use to request services from other applications or services. APIs are the backbone of modern software development, enabling applications to communicate with each other seamlessly.
API Management
API management is the process of controlling access to and the use of APIs within an organization. It involves creating, publishing, maintaining, and monitoring APIs to ensure they are secure, reliable, and scalable. API management also includes tasks such as versioning, rate limiting, authentication, and analytics.
The Role of an API Gateway
What is an API Gateway?
An API gateway is a server that acts as an entry point for all API requests. It is responsible for routing requests to the appropriate backend services, managing security, and providing a single interface for API consumers.
Benefits of Using an API Gateway
- Centralized Security: An API gateway can enforce security policies across all APIs, making it easier to manage and secure your API ecosystem.
- Rate Limiting: API gateways can limit the number of requests per second or minute to prevent abuse and ensure fair usage.
- Caching: Caching can improve performance by storing frequently accessed data, reducing the load on backend services.
- Monitoring and Analytics: API gateways can provide insights into API usage, helping organizations understand their API ecosystem better.

The Importance of an API Developer Portal
What is an API Developer Portal?
An API developer portal is a web-based platform that provides developers with access to APIs, documentation, and other resources they need to build applications. It serves as a single point of contact for developers, making it easier for them to understand and use your APIs.
Benefits of Using an API Developer Portal
- Self-service Access: Developers can register for APIs, access documentation, and try out API endpoints without the need for manual intervention.
- Documentation: A developer portal provides comprehensive documentation for APIs, including endpoints, request/response formats, and usage examples.
- Feedback and Support: Developers can submit feedback, report issues, and receive support through the developer portal.
API Governance
What is API Governance?
API governance is the set of policies, standards, and processes that ensure APIs are developed, deployed, and managed in a consistent and secure manner. It helps organizations maintain control over their API ecosystem and ensures compliance with internal and external standards.
Key Components of API Governance
- Policy Management: Defining and enforcing policies related to API development, deployment, and usage.
- Standards Compliance: Ensuring APIs adhere to industry standards and best practices.
- Risk Management: Identifying and mitigating risks associated with API usage and exposure.
